好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

数字逻辑第四章课后答案..范本.docx

17页
  • 卖家[上传人]:1824****985
  • 文档编号:278989628
  • 上传时间:2022-04-18
  • 文档格式:DOCX
  • 文档大小:15.16KB
  • / 17 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 数字逻辑第四章课后答案.. 习题4解答 4-1 试用与非门设计实现函数F(A,B,C,D)=Σm(0,2,5,8,11,13,15)的组合逻辑电路 解:首先用卡诺图对函数进行化简,然后变换成与非-与非表达式 化简后的函数 4-2 试用逻辑门设计三变量的奇数判别电路若输入变量中1的个数为奇数时,输出为1,否则输出为0 解:本题的函数不能化简,但可以变换成异或表达式,使电路实现最简 真值表:逻辑函数表达式: C B A C B A C B A C B A Y? ? + ? ? + ? ? + ? ? = C B A⊕ ⊕ =) ( ACD D C B D B A D C B ACD D C B D B A D C B ACD D C B D B A D C B F ? ? ? ? ? ? ? = + + ? ? + ? ? = + + ? ? + ? ? = 逻辑图 B A C D F 4-3 用与非门设计四变量多数表决电路。

      当输入变量A 、B 、C 、D 有三个或三个以上为1时输出为1,输入为其他状态时输出为0 解: 真值表: 先用卡诺图化简,然后变换成与非-与非表达式: 逻辑函数表达式: 4-4 用门电路设计一个代码转换电路,输入为4位二进制代码,输出为 4位循环码 解:首先根据所给问题列出真值表,然后用卡诺图化简逻辑函数,按照化简后的逻辑函数画逻辑图 ACD BCD ABC ABD ACD BCD ABC ABD ACD BCD ABC ABD Y ???=+++=+++=逻辑图 真值表: 卡诺图化简: 化简后的逻辑函数: Y 1的卡诺图 Y 2的卡诺图 Y 3的卡诺图 Y 4的卡诺图 A Y =1B A B A B A Y ⊕=+=2C B C B C B Y ⊕=+=3D C D C D C Y ⊕=+=4Y Y 逻辑图 4-5 图4.48所示是一个由两台水泵向水池供水的系统。

      水池中安置了A 、B 、C 三个水位传感器当水池水位低于C 点时,两台水泵同时供水当水池水位低于B 点且高于C 点时,由水泵M1单独供水当水池水位低于A 点且高于B 点时,由水泵M2单独供水当水池水位高于A 点时,两台水泵都停止供水试设计一个水泵控制电路要求电路尽可能简单 图4.48 习题4-5的示意图 解:设水位低于传感器时,水位传感器的输出为1,水位高于传感器时,水位传感器的输出为0 首先根据所给问题列出真值表其中有几种情况是不可能出现的,用约束项表示 如果利用约束项化简 如果不利用约束项化简 (a) 用约束项化简 (b) 不用约束项化简 M 1的卡诺图 M 2的卡诺图 B M =1B A C M +=2AB M =1C B A AB C M ?+=2B ) (C B A ⊕=逻辑图 习题4-5的逻辑图 4-6 试用3线-8线译码器74HC138和门电路实现如下多输出逻辑函数并画出逻辑图。

      解:先将逻辑函数变换成最小项之和的形式 再变换成与74HC138一致的形式 令74HC138的A 2= A ,A 1=B ,A 0= C , 4-7 试用3线-8线译码器74HC138和逻辑门设计一组合电路该电路输入X ,输出Y 均为3位二进制数二者之间关系如下: 当2≤X <7时, Y=X -2 X<2时, Y=1 X =7时, Y=6 解:首先根据所给问题列出真值表 C B A C AB C B A BC A Y ?++??+=2C B A C B A BC A C B A C A B A C B A Y ?+++=++=1C B A C B A BC A ABC AC B A Y +++=+=3 1 2351m m m m C B A C B A BC A C B A Y ???=?+++=2 3472 m m m m C B A ABC C B A BC A Y ???=?++??+=2 3573m m m m C B A C B A BC A ABC Y ???=+++=0 74m m C B A ABC Y ?=??+=)(1C B A C B A Y ++=B A C A Y +=2C B A AB C Y ??+=4) )((3C A B A Y ++=逻辑图 逻辑图 Y 2 Y 1 Y 0 逻辑函数: 4-8 试用4选1数据选择器产生逻辑函数 解:将逻辑函数变换成最小项之和的形式 若用输入变量AB 作为地址,C 作为数据输入,则 即A 1=A ,A 0=B ,D 0= D 2= ,D 1=1,D 3=C 。

      逻辑图如下图(a)所示 若用输入变量AC 作为地址, B 作为数据输入,则 即A 1=A ,A 0=C ,D 0=1, D 2= ,D 1=D 3= B 逻辑图如下图(b)所示 (a) AB 作为地址 (b) AC 作为地址 4-9 分析图4.49所示电路,写出输出Y 的逻辑函数式并化简 C D BC A ABC C B A C B A C B A Y ++??++?=BC C A C B A Y +?+??=ABC C B A B A C B A Y +??+?+?=1C CB A B AC C A B C A Y +?+??+?=1B Y 7547541m m m m m m Y ??=++=531053100m m m m m m m m Y ???=+++=76762m m m m Y ?=+= 图4.49 习题4-9的电路 解:8选1数据选择器 C =A 2,B=A 1,A =A 0, D 7= D 3 =0,D 2=1,D 5=D 4= D 1= D 0=D ,D 6= , 逻辑函数 卡诺图化简 化简后的逻辑函数 4-10 试用8选1数据选择器产生逻辑函数 解: 令A=A 2,B=A 1,C=A 0,D 7= D 5= D 2= D 1=1,D 6= D 4= D 3= D 0=0, 4-11 试用3线-8线译码器74HC138和最少数量的二输入逻辑门设计一个不一致电路。

      当A 、B 、C 三个输入不一致时,输出为1,三个输入一致时,输出为0 C B A C B A AC Y ?++=C B A C B A C B A ABC C B A C B A AC Y ?+++=?++= B C D A B C D A B C D A B C A B DC A B DC A CB D Y ??+?++?++= A C D B D A B D Y ?++=逻辑图 解:首先根据所给问题列出真值表 真值表: 如果直接按照真值表写出逻辑函数表达式,很难用二输入逻辑门实现但是,观察真值表不难发现,真值表中只有两行的Y 为0,因此,按照真值表写出反函数表达式,应该容易用二输入逻辑门实现 逻辑函数表达式: 题目要求用3线-8线译码器74HC138实现,而74HC138的每个输出对应一个最小项的反,因此,还必须把逻辑函数式变换成与74HC138的逻辑函数相同的形式 ABC C B A Y Y +??== 7 0m m ABC C B A ABC C B A Y ?=???=+??=ABC C B A Y +??=逻辑图 4-12 试用8选1数据选择器产生逻辑函数 解: 如果用ABC 作为数据选择器的地址(A=A 2,B=A 1,C=A 0),D 作为数据,则函数变换成 D 7= D 6=D 3 =1, D 5= D 0=0, D 4= D 1=D , D 2= , 如果用BCD 作为数据选择器的地址(B=A 2,C=A 1,D=A 0),A 作为数据, 则函数变换成 D 7= D 6= D 4=1,D 2= D 0=0, D 5= D 1=A , D 3 = 4-13 根据表4.23所示的功能表设计一个函数发生器电路,用8选1数据选择器实现。

      表4.23 习题4-13的功能表 D C B BC ABC D CD B A D C A Y ?+++?+=D C B A D C AB D BC A BCD A D ABC ABCD CD B A D 。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.